The Historic Function of Liquor in Cultures Worldwide
Throughout history, liquor has actually worked as a significant cultural aspect, forming social interactions throughout varied cultures. In old human beings, such as Mesopotamia and Egypt, alcohol was typically seen as a present from the gods, made use of in spiritual events and common feasts. The Greeks celebrated the wine god Dionysus, highlighting the link in between intoxication and social bonding. In middle ages Europe, taverns became hubs for neighborhood interaction, where people collected to share stories and create links. As societies progressed, so did the duty of liquor; it came to be a symbol of friendliness and camaraderie. Unique customs bordering alcohol established, mirroring neighborhood customizeds and worths. From the benefit of Japan to the tequila of Mexico, these drinks not only enhanced cooking experiences however additionally fostered a sense of identification and belonging. The historical value of alcohol reveals its enduring influence on social dynamics across the world.
Traditions and routines Surrounding Alcohol in Events
Alcohol plays a central role in numerous rituals and traditions during celebrations worldwide, enhancing social bonds and improving the festive ambience. In several cultures, the act of toasting is a fundamental routine, where individuals elevate their glasses to recognize significant milestones and share a good reputation. For example, champagne is usually uncorked during wedding events, signifying joy and new beginnings.In various other practices, certain alcohols are connected to vacations, such as eggnog throughout Xmas or benefit during Japanese New Year celebrations, each carrying unique cultural significance.Moreover, communal alcohol consumption rituals, such as sharing a public cup or taking part in a round of beverages, cultivate a sense of unity among participants.These practices show the multifaceted duty of alcohol in events, serving not only as a beverage but as a driver for link, joy, and cultural expression. Through these rituals, the act of alcohol consumption goes beyond plain consumption, becoming a crucial part of the commemorative experience.

How Different Cultures Commemorate With Liquor
While several cultures integrate alcohol into their events, the relevance and fashion of its usage can differ widely. In Mexico, for instance, tequila plays a central function in carnivals, signifying delight and friendship. During Diwali, the Festival of Lighting in India, specific areas commemorate with whiskey and rum, representing success and great fortune. Conversely, in Japan, sake is usually appreciated during standard events, embodying spiritual pureness and harmony.In Russia, vodka is an integral part of social gatherings, with rituals stressing friendliness and relationship. On the other hand, partly of Germany, beer takes facility phase during Oktoberfest, highlighting community and social heritage. Each culture has its special customs bordering liquor, shaping not just the beverages eaten but likewise the overall ambience of the event. These differences reflect much deeper social worths, making alcohol a crucial aspect that enriches cultural celebrations throughout the globe.

Background of Toasting
Throughout background, the act of elevating a glass has worked as a powerful ritual that promotes link among people. Coming from in old times, toasting was a means to ensure trust amongst enthusiasts, as sharing a drink indicated a lack of sick intent. The Greeks and Romans elevated this practice, using it to recognize gods and celebrate success. In middle ages Europe, toasting became a social standard, typically come with by intricate speeches to commemorate friendship and goodwill. As societies developed, so did the nuances of toasting, with each society installing its distinct customs and significances. Today, toasting remains a global motion, representing friendship and shared experiences, strengthening bonds that go beyond generations and geographical boundaries.
Toasting Decorum Fundamentals
The art of toasting exceeds simple ritual; it personifies a collection of decorum that enhances the experience of connection among participants. A well-executed toast requires a couple of crucial aspects: clearness, sincerity, and brevity. The salute should begin with a mild clinking of glasses, followed by the speaker dealing with the target market with eye call. It is necessary to maintain the message positive, concentrating on shared experiences or the guest of honor. Timing additionally matters; salutes should happen at ideal minutes, preferably before the dish or throughout considerable events. Finally, individuals must avoid alcohol consumption up until the salute ends, enabling a minute of unity. Mastering these essentials cultivates a deeper bond among attendees and improves social communications.
